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: problem z eregi
Forum PHP.pl > Forum > Przedszkole
kari
staram się za pomocą eregi() sprawdzić czy w jakimś tam ciągu "$wartosc" znajduje się data podawana jako zmienna "$data".
$wartość ma postać: $wartość = aaaaa#bbbbb#ccccc#16.03.05-15:53:08#;

ale jakoś wszystko co zrobie niechce mi działać. kiedy zamiast daty podawanej w zmiennej, podam jakiś zwykły wyraz, to wszystko działa??
Vertical
Co masz na myśli mówiąc "zwykły wyraz" ? Może pokażesz treść tego skryptu?
Michał2000
Może sprubuj czegos takiego:
eregi([0-9]+\.[0-9]+\.[0-9]+-[0-9]+\.[0-9]+\.[0-9]+)

Niewiem czy zadziała i nie wiem czy oto ci chodziło.
crash
Użyj wyrażenia: [0-9]{2}\.[0-9]{2}\.[0-9]{2}-[0-9]{2}:[0-9]{2}:[0-9]{2} (chyba o to Ci chodzi, niezbyt zrozumiały był ten Twój post...).
Michał2000
No własnie... ten crashu'ego jest dobry. Jesli o to ci chodzi smile.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.